European Restructuring Practices of Major U.S. Law Firms 2020

Turnarounds & Workouts recognized Kirkland & Ellis on its list of top European Restructuring Practices of Major U.S. Law Firms.

The September 2020 special report cited the Firm’s work for regulator/contingent creditor of Virgin Atlantic Airways; PizzaExpress; financial creditors to Steinhoff; Technicolor; Wirecard bondholders; certain bondholders to Thomas Cook; Intelsat; NMC Health; Hertz Europe bondholders; HEMA bondholders; Forever 21; Travelodge; Valaris; new money provider to Cineworld; AllSaints; Casual Dining Group; Matalan bondholders; Selecta; landlord to Four Seasons Health Care; German Property Group; Getronics’ lenders; Survitec Group Limited’s lenders; Telepizza; new money provider to Petroleum Geo-Services; and Outdoor and Cycle Concepts.

Restructuring partners Kon Asimacopoulos, Partha Kar, Sean Lacey, Sacha Lürken, Bernd Meyer-Löwy, Elaine Nolan, Leo Plank, Wolfram Prusko, Kate Stephenson and James Watson were listed as senior professionals in the group.
